                                In the summer of 2005, a group of Cabrillo Alumni and Staff met to share

ideas about creating an alumni association to honor notable alumni and staff who have attended or worked at Cabrillo High School. The first Hall-of-Fame Induction Dinner was held in 2006 honoring Evert Jones (Cabrillo’s First Head Football Coach) as our first inductee. 

                                 

                             Since that time, we have had a total of 34 outstanding inductees into the

CHS Alumni Hall-of-Fame (4 groups/teams, 22 alumni and 18 honored staff). The Hall-of-Fame is open to all graduates who have achieved honors in academics, activities, athletics and/or performing arts at CHS. In addition, they have achieved extraordinary success in their career field and have contributed in a positive way to their community. Staff members can be recognized for their contribution and impact to the students at CHS. Groups or Teams may be recognized for bringing local, state and national recognition to Cabrillo High School.

                                   

                              Annually, members of the CHS Alumni Association nominate potential candidates f

 or the next HOF class. The list of nominees is then sent to the HOF selection committee for final vote. In March of each year, the new HOF Induction Class is announced and our annual Hall-of-Fame Induction Dinner is held in early August. Over the past years, this dinner has become a very successful event and many times is held during a class or multi-class reunion weekend.
